- // 22.2.3.1 RegExp ( pattern, flags ), https://tc39.es/ecma262/#sec-regexp-pattern-flags
- ThrowCompletionOr<Value> RegExpConstructor::call()
- {
- auto& vm = this->vm();
- auto pattern = vm.argument(0);
- auto flags = vm.argument(1);
- // 1. Let patternIsRegExp be ? IsRegExp(pattern).
- bool pattern_is_regexp = TRY(pattern.is_regexp(vm));
- // 2. If NewTarget is undefined, then
- // a. Let newTarget be the active function object.
- auto& new_target = *this;
- // b. If patternIsRegExp is true and flags is undefined, then
- if (pattern_is_regexp && flags.is_undefined()) {
- // i. Let patternConstructor be ? Get(pattern, "constructor").
- auto pattern_constructor = TRY(pattern.as_object().get(vm.names.constructor));
- // ii. If SameValue(newTarget, patternConstructor) is true, return pattern.
- if (same_value(&new_target, pattern_constructor))
- return pattern;
- }
- return TRY(construct(new_target));
- }
- // 22.2.3.1 RegExp ( pattern, flags ), https://tc39.es/ecma262/#sec-regexp-pattern-flags
- ThrowCompletionOr<NonnullGCPtr<Object>> RegExpConstructor::construct(FunctionObject& new_target)
- {
- auto& vm = this->vm();
- auto pattern = vm.argument(0);
- auto flags = vm.argument(1);
- // 1. Let patternIsRegExp be ? IsRegExp(pattern).
- bool pattern_is_regexp = TRY(pattern.is_regexp(vm));
- // NOTE: Step 2 is handled in call() above.
- // 3. Else, let newTarget be NewTarget.
- Value pattern_value;
- Value flags_value;
- // 4. If pattern is an Object and pattern has a [[RegExpMatcher]] internal slot, then
- if (pattern.is_object() && is<RegExpObject>(pattern.as_object())) {
- // a. Let P be pattern.[[OriginalSource]].
- auto& regexp_pattern = static_cast<RegExpObject&>(pattern.as_object());
- pattern_value = PrimitiveString::create(vm, regexp_pattern.pattern());
- // b. If flags is undefined, let F be pattern.[[OriginalFlags]].
- if (flags.is_undefined())
- flags_value = PrimitiveString::create(vm, regexp_pattern.flags());
- // c. Else, let F be flags.
- else
- flags_value = flags;
- }
- // 5. Else if patternIsRegExp is true, then
- else if (pattern_is_regexp) {
- // a. Let P be ? Get(pattern, "source").
- pattern_value = TRY(pattern.as_object().get(vm.names.source));
- // b. If flags is undefined, then
- if (flags.is_undefined()) {
- // i. Let F be ? Get(pattern, "flags").
- flags_value = TRY(pattern.as_object().get(vm.names.flags));
- }
- // c. Else, let F be flags.
- else {
- flags_value = flags;
- }
- }
- // 6. Else,
- else {
- // a. Let P be pattern.
- pattern_value = pattern;
- // b. Let F be flags.
- flags_value = flags;
- }
- // 7. Let O be ? RegExpAlloc(newTarget).
- auto regexp_object = TRY(regexp_alloc(vm, new_target));
- // 8. Return ? RegExpInitialize(O, P, F).
- return TRY(regexp_object->regexp_initialize(vm, pattern_value, flags_value));
- }
